A minimum of 60 semester credit hours must be transferred from an associate degree in a health care related discipline from Herzing University or another nationally or regionally accredited college or university. Applicable associated degree disciplines include but are not limited to: laboratory technology, medical assisting, medical billing, medical coding, medical office administration, nursing, surgical technology, radiologic technology, physical therapist assistant, and therapeutic massage.
The program prepares students with the necessary skills and academic knowledge for entry-level or management training positions in health care management as well as various other business enterprises, such as business administration and human resources.
Potential entry-level and management training position titles include human resources representative, client services representative, office manager, health care administrator, or medical office manager.
This program is offered in three formats: Traditional Classroom, Online, and Accelerated. Not all formats are available at all campuses for all courses.
